BoE identifies 19 terror suspects

Published August 12, 2006

LONDON, Aug 11: Names of 19 UK residents arrested in connection with an alleged terror plot to blow up airplanes, as released by the Bank of England: Abdula Ahmed Ali, 25; Cossor Ali, 23; Ibrahim Savant, 25; Amin Asmin Tariq, 23; Shamin Mohammed Uddin, 35; Waheed Zaman, 22; Nabeel Hussain, 22; Tanvir Hussain, 25; Umair Hussain, 24; Assan Abdullah Khan, 21; Waheed Arafat Khan, 25; Osman Adam Khatib, 19; Abdul Muneem Patel, 17; Muhammed Usman Saddique, 24, (all from London); Umar Islam, 28; Waseem Kayani, 29; Shazad Khuram Ali, 27, and Assad Sarwar, 26, (from High Wycombe area) and Tayib Rauf, 22, of Birmingham.—AP
